Research from build to rent specialists, Ascend Properties, has revealed which lifestyle features the build to rent market is currently catering for most to appeal to the modern-day resident, based on an analysis of current stock available on the market.

Pet rentals have been a hot topic in recent times and despite the governmentโ€™s changes to the model tenancy agreement preventing a blanket ban, landlords are still able to decline an application with good reason.

However, the build to rent sector is leading the change in this respect, with 49% of all developments listed as pet friendly, the most prominent lifestyle feature of all those analysed.

The more traditional requirement of parking was the next most prominent feature with 41% of developments offering additional space for a car, with a concierge also ranking high (34%).

With much of the modern world focussed around online connectivity, and lockdown restrictions increasing this importance in recent times, free Wi-Fi was also a prominent offering across current build to rent developments (28%).

However, technology is no substitute for real-life interaction and with the build to rent focus also centred around creating a community, a residents lounge (25%), on-site gym (23%) and communal gardens (13%) also ranked fairly high.

The least widely available build to rent features currently include the ability to rent without a deposit (11%) and a roof terrace (7%).

Managing Director of Ascend Properties, Ged McPartlin, commented: โ€œThe whole focus of the build to rent sector is centred around creating a long-term rental option that provides the same benefits as homeownership and more. The decision to bring a pet into your home is often a long-term commitment and so itโ€™s great to see the sector is offering an abundance of homes that allow residents to own a pet. This further highlights the long-term, lifestyle focussed offering the sector can provide.

Thatโ€™s not to say that some of the more traditional features arenโ€™t also an integral part of our daily lives and by providing the old and the new with features such as parking, free Wi-Fi and more, the build to rent sector really does offer an option that addresses every need of the modern-day resident.โ€
